About Piney Point, MD

Piney Point is a small town located in Maryland with a population of 1,171 residents according to the latest US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The median household income is $114,271 per year, which is 52% above the national median of $75,149. The median age of 38.9 years is close to the US median age of 38.9 years.

Housing Market Overview

The housing market in Piney Point features a median home value of $343,300, which is 40% above the national median of $244,900. This positions Piney Point in a moderately priced market relative to the rest of the country. Median monthly rent is $1,645, 41% above the national average of $1,163/month. Of the 509 total housing units, 73% are owner-occupied (335 units) and 27% are renter-occupied (124 units). The high homeownership rate suggests a stable, established residential community.

Economy & Employment

The local economy in Piney Point shows an unemployment rate of 7.3%, which is significantly above the national rate of 3.7%, suggesting economic challenges in the area. The poverty rate stands at 0.7%, below the national average of 12.4%, reflecting generally favorable economic conditions. Workers in Piney Point have an average one-way commute time of 28.2 minutes.

Education & Demographics

33.3% of Piney Point resid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her, compared to the national average of 33.7%. This is in line with national trends in educational attainment.
